Модераторы: gambit
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> Развертывание WCF Data Service 
:(
    Опции темы
Ruzl
Дата 24.8.2010, 14:39 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 42
Регистрация: 9.2.2008

Репутация: нет
Всего: 1



Доброго времени суток. 
Пытаюсь развернуть Data Service под IIS7. при запросе всегда выпадает ошибка "The type 'Service.DataService', provided as the Service attribute value in the ServiceHost directive, or provided in the configuration element system.serviceModel/serviceHostingEnvironment/serviceActivations could not be found."

вот пример объявления сервиса:

Код

namespace Service
{
    public class DataService : DataService<dataModelEntites>
    {
       
        public static void InitializeService(DataServiceConfiguration config)
        {
             config.SetEntitySetAccessRule("*", EntitySetRights.All);
            config.DataServiceBehavior.MaxProtocolVersion = DataServiceProtocolVersion.V2;
        }
    }
}



и веб-конфига:

Код

<system.serviceModel>
    <services>
      <service name="Service.DataService, Service">
        <endpoint address="SomeBind" binding="WebHttpBinding" contract="System.Data.Services.IRequestHandler">
        </endpoint>
      </service>
    </services>
  </system.serviceModel>

при этом в папке, на которую натравлено виртуальное приложение, присутствует и DataService.svc и Web.config и Service.dll.

Подскажите в чем может быть ошибка, заранее благодарен. 

PM MAIL   Вверх
jonie
Дата 24.8.2010, 18:57 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Эксперт
****


Профиль
Группа: Завсегдатай
Сообщений: 5613
Регистрация: 21.8.2005
Где: Владимир

Репутация: 15
Всего: 118



Цитата

при этом в папке, на которую натравлено виртуальное приложение, присутствует и DataService.svc и Web.config и Service.dll.
DLL-ки должны лежать в /bin каталоге, в отладке вам поможет fuslogvw утилита

Цитата

Тhe service code can then reside inline as shown in Listing 5-3, in a separate assembly registered in the GAC, in an assembly that resides in the application's Bin folder, or in a C# file that resides under the application's App_Code folder. 
© msdn.microsoft.com/en-us/library/bb332338.aspx

Это сообщение отредактировал(а) jonie - 24.8.2010, 19:00


--------------------
Что-то не поняли? -> Напейтесь до зеленых человечков... эта сверхцивилизация Вам поможет...
PM MAIL Jabber   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
Прежде чем создать тему, посмотрите сюда:
cully
mr.DUDA
Exception

Используйте теги [code=csharp][/code] для подсветки кода. Используйтe чекбокс "транслит" если у Вас нет русских шрифтов.

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, cully, mr.DUDA, Exception.

 
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| Распределённые приложения и сеть | Следующая тема »


 




[ Время генерации скрипта: 0.0616 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.